About this property
Beautifully maintained traditional ranch-style home conveniently located just 15 miles south of Downtown Dallas and approximately 30 miles from DFW International Airport. Enjoy easy access to shopping, restaurants, medical facilities, and places of worship, all just minutes away. Inside, you'll find a carpet-free interior featuring laminate wood flooring throughout the living area and bedrooms, with ceramic tile in the kitchen, baths, and utility spaces. The spacious living room offers plenty of room for relaxing or entertaining and is anchored by a charming wood-burning fireplace with a gas starter. The bright eat-in kitchen is thoughtfully designed with granite countertops, ample cabinet and counter space, a built-in microwave, dishwasher, and abundant natural light. A generously sized utility room provides additional pantry and storage options. Step outside to a large backyard with an open patio, perfect for outdoor gatherings or simply enjoying the Texas weather. The rear-entry garage accommodates one full-size vehicle and one compact vehicle. Nature lovers will appreciate being just a short walk from Murphy Hills Park, a scenic neighborhood park situated along the banks of Ten Mile Creek. Park amenities include a playground, basketball court, and access to walking and jogging trails, providing excellent opportunities for outdoor recreation close to home. Learn About the Market: Opportunity in Texas




Explore
Texas
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
